Richemont acquires full control of Net-A-Porter

Nathan Golia

Swiss luxury retailer Richemont agreed to acquire the rest of London-based luxury e-commerce site Net-A-Porter.com on April 1. Prior to the deal, Richemont owned 33% of the company. The deal is valued at $343 million.
 

SAMHSA, Ad Council address teen suicide

Dianna Dilworth

The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ration (SAMHSA) has joined the Ad Council and the Inspire USA Foundation to conduct a PSA-focused integrated campaign to reduce teen suicide. DDB New York created the push, which launched April 1.
 

Zwinky.com, TheTruth.com team up for anti-teen smoking campaign

Dianna Dilworth

Zwinky.com, IAC's virtual community, has partnered with TheTruth.com on a digital campaign urging teens to avoid smoking. The push launched April 2.

Golf Direct On-Course and Sampling Program

New insert program — Golf Direct On-Course and Sampling Program — PlusMedia — This file offers placement in a golf-centered publication handed out at courses. Readers are 78% male with an average age of 46 and average income of $95,000. Nearly all are homeowners and more than half are married.
 

National Geographic Members International

New list — National Geographic Members International — Mardev-DM2 — This file contains international members of the National Geographic Society, who receive the English language edition of National Geographic magazine as a benefit of membership. Seventy percent are male.
 

Shutterfly Photos Packages

New insert program — Shutterfly Photos Packages — Leon Henry Inc. — This file places inserts into outbound print orders fulfilled by Shutterfly, a Web site that enables consumers to share, print and preserve their digital photos. Average age is 35. The file is 80% female. Average income is $60,000.
